Q – We’re getting married next December, and I’m not sure when to have my dress alterations done or what to do with the leftover fabric. Do you have any suggestions?

A – "Most seamstresses are booked up quite far in advance, so I would always recommend you secure a booking as soon as possible. Discuss with the seamstress the type of alterations that you might need carried out. Having the length altered can be done a few weeks before the wedding but if you’ve bought a sample dress that needs resizing, be prepared that it could take up to eight weeks with numerous fittings.

"Excess fabric can be be used to tie around your bouquets, or if you have an amazing supplier, you could suggest they make an accessory such as a garter, hairpiece or a bridal sash."
